主要观点总结
本文详细探讨了异地多活架构在设计基础架构时需要考虑的关键点,包括接入层、逻辑层和数据层的影响,以及数据复制架构和路由策略的选择。
关键观点总结
关键观点1: 关于基础架构
讨论了信息技术的发展对基础架构设计的影响,包括应对复杂业务和大数据量的挑战,以及解决高可用、高性能、高扩展、低成本和安全等关键问题的必要性。
关键观点2: 关于异地多活
重点介绍了需要考虑异地多活的情况,以及在解决城市级别的单点故障时面临的挑战。讨论了实现异地多活的关键在于数据层的写操作,包括数据同步、备份和容灾策略。
关键观点3: 关于数据层的影响
详细探讨了数据层的操作,包括读和写。重点强调了写操作的重要性,以及解决写时延、写量大和隔离问题的必要性。讨论了数据模型、副本管理、缓存机制和连接管理等方面的影响。
关键观点4: 数据复制架构
介绍了多种数据复制架构,包括三地五中心、三地三中心、同城三中心、双主互复制等,并探讨了这些架构的优缺点和适用场景。还介绍了对等同城三中心和双主互复制中可能出现的问题及其解决方案。
关键观点5: 数据影响路由
探讨了不同数据形态对路由的影响,包括跨城全局数据、就近分片数据和跨城分片数据的路由策略。重点强调了解决跨城时延问题的必要性,以及如何在接入层进行路由分流。
关键观点6: 架构选型模式
提供了在进行架构设计时的考量评估步骤,包括关键因素如成本、吞吐量、机器资源等。强调要根据业务具体情况进行具体分析。
免责声明
免责声明:本文内容摘要由平台算法生成,仅为信息导航参考,不代表原文立场或观点。
原文内容版权归原作者所有,如您为原作者并希望删除该摘要或链接,请通过
【版权申诉通道】联系我们处理。